How would you build systems that evolve over time to proactively identify and neutralize new and emerging abuse threats?Our mission in Buyer Risk Prevention (BRP) is to make Amazon.com the safest place to transact online. BRP safeguards every financial transaction across all Amazon sites, while striving to ensure that these efforts are transparent to our legitimate customers. As such, BRP designs and builds the software systems, risk models and operational processes that minimize risk and maximize trust in Amazon.comKey job responsibilitiesRisk Analyst will own analytical deep dives to identify emerging abuse patterns and communicate findings to ML teams, Program Managers and other cross-functional partners. The successful candidate will demonstrate an ability to thrive in a fast-paced and challenging environment and partner with stakeholders across multiple domains.A day in the life

Role

A typical day for a Risk Analyst revolves around leveraging advanced analytical techniques and tools to uncover patterns, anomalies, and potential abuse schemes. This role will:
  • Provide time sensitive analytics to partner teams
  • Deep Dive on emerging abuse patterns using SQL on large datasets
  • Identify root cause and work with partners such as ML teams to develop sustainable solutions.

About The Team

Abuse Risk Mining Analytics' mission is to combine the latest data science techniques with investigator insights to detect and prevent abuse & negative customer experiences across Amazon.
